"An intimate new portrait of the bold and determined woman who saved Dostoyevsky's life-and became a pioneer in Russian literary history In the fall of 1866-against the backdrop of Russia's first feminist movement-an independent-minded young stenographer named Anna Snitkina went to work for a writer she idolized: Fyodor Dostoyevsky.
